Some basic setup instructions for Ubuntu

sudo apt-get install mysql-client mysql-server libmysql-ruby libmysqlclient-dev

sudo apt-get install curl

\curl -L get.rvm.io | bash -s stable

source ~/.rvm/scripts/rvm

rvm requirements

rvm install ruby

rvm use ruby –default

rvm rubygems current

You’ll need to copy config/database.yml.sample to config/database.yml

rvm gemset create becamp

rvm gemset use becamp

bundle install

rake db:setup

rake db:migrate
